History[]
Judge McGruder is a supporting character from the 2000 AD strip Judge Dredd. She was the head of the Special Judicial Squad, which was set up to investigate corruption in Mega-City One's Justice Department. When Dredd was taken prisoner during The Apocalypse War and Chief Judge Griffin had died, McGruder led the battle against the Sov-Block invaders. After the war ended in 2104 AD she was declared Chief Judge by default since she was the only member of the city's ruling Council of Five still alive.
After four years in office, McGruder resigned and took the Long Walk into the Cursed Earth, considering herself unfit for office after she failed to prevent a massacre. She returned several years later to help save the city from the Dark Judges during the Necropolis incident. Her years in the Cursed Earth had taken a toll on her — she had apparently developed Multiple Personality Disorder and had definitely grown a beard. McGruder was nevertheless re-elected Chief Judge for a second term in 2113 AD in the absence of any other suitable candidate (despite an attempt by the undead Chief Judge Silver to usurp her position). She went on to provide valuable global leadership during the worldwide zombie epidemic that came to be known as Judgement Day.
Sadly, McGruder's mental health continued to deteriorate, to the point where she endangered the city with the Mechanismo Project, creating robot Judges which proved unstable and dangerous. (To be fair, Tek-Division really dropped the ball on that one, and deserve at least some of the blame. There are thousands of robots in Mega-City One with complex personalities, so why is it so hard to create robot Judges?). Finally stepping down again in 2116 AD after one of her own robot Judges tried to kill her on the planet Hestia and she realised she was unfit to continue, McGruder went off to write her memoirs.
Some years later, Judge Dredd learned that McGruder, now suffering from Alzheimer's disease, was about to face compulsory euthanasia. Unwilling to see her die in such an ignoble manner, he kidnapped her and took her back to the Cursed Earth in order to allow her to end her life honourably fighting for justice. McGruder was fatally wounded in a shoot-out with a band of cannibals and died in Dredd's arms. The facts surrounding her death were suppressed.
Powers and abilities[]
Abilities
Leadership skills; survival skills.
Strength level
Elderly human female who gets regular exercise.
Weaknesses
Mental health issues.
Paraphernalia[]
Equipment
Bionic hand; earrings with little skulls on; earrings bearing the logo of the Justice Department; ring with a skull on; accessory pouch containing three heatseeker shells; helmet containing internal visor display (including infra-red) and respirator; uniform made from plasti-steel reinforced material.
Transportation
Lawmaster bike.
Weapons
Lawgiver handgun which can fire six types of shell: heatseeker, rubber ricochet, incendiary, armour-piercing, high explosive and standard execution. Also daystick and bootknife.
Notes[]
McGruder's first names are those of former Prime Minister Margaret Hilda Thatcher, who was in office when she was created.
Trivia[]
- As McGruder's mental health worsened she started referring to herself in the first person plural. This idiosyncrasy was probably meant to remind readers of Margaret Thatcher's famously odd announcement, "We have become a grandmother."
- A street in Mega-City One and an orbital weapons platform are named after McGruder.
- The K-3000 Superheavy Class Tac-wagon is also known as 'the McGruder', because "it doesn't take any crap from anyone that gets in its way."
- There is a large picture of McGruder on the wall of the office of the head of the SJS.
